Biblica Analytica

אוֹצָר

o.tsar (H0214)

treasure

79 verses 19 books OT 70 / NT 0
AI Word Study

The Hebrew word "אוֹצָר" (o.tsar) is defined as "treasure." It falls within the semantic domain of Commerce & Wealth, indicating its primary association with valuable possessions or riches. This word appears 79 times in the Bible, suggesting its significance in various contexts. In its usage, "אוֹצָר" often refers to accumulated wealth, riches, or valuable possessions. It can also imply a storehouse or repository for these treasures. The word's frequency in the Bible highlights its importance in discussions of wealth, prosperity, and material possessions. It is used in a range of texts, from descriptions of royal wealth to warnings about the dangers of materialism. The significance of "אוֹצָר" lies in its representation of the value and importance placed on material possessions in ancient Hebrew culture. Its frequent appearance in the Bible underscores the relevance of these issues to the lives of ancient Israelites, and its continued use today serves as a reminder of the ongoing human concern with wealth and prosperity.
